The Bisha BESS, owned by Saudi Electric Company , comprises 122 prefabricated storage units designed and supplied by China’s BYD. Each unit integrates a 6 MW power conversion system with four lithium iron phosphate battery modules, each boasting a capacity of 5.365 MWh. [pdf]

Sun Village and Huawei sign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) on May 14, 2025. Under the MoU, Sun Village will target procuring 500MWh of battery storage systems from the Chinese manufacturer. [pdf]
China-based energy storage solutions manufacturer HiTHIUM has secured a contract from the Saudi Electricity Company (SEC) to implement two battery energy storage system (BESS) projects with a combined capacity of 4 gigawatt hours (GWh), in the northern provinces of Tabuk and Hail, Saudi Arabia.
